Purpose: To evaluate perinatal outcomes and maternal human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) disease progression in pregnant womenMethods: Retrospective multicentric review of a cohort of 34 HIV-positive pregnant women delivering at four Turkish hospitals (2009-2021).Data included obstetric/neonatal parameters and serial laboratory values.Results: Mean maternal age was 30.8±3.3 years and 52.9% were diagnosed during pregnancy.HIV viral load remained suppressed [median 254 copies/mL interquartile range (IQR: 50-1200) in first trimester and 211 copies/mL (IQR: 40-900) at delivery].Mean birth weight was 2351.8±727.0g.Pregnancy complications included premature rupture of membranes (29.4%), preterm labor (23.5%), and placental abruption (5.9%).Among 32 infants followed-up, none acquired HIV (0% mother-to-child transmission but two lost to follow-up).No maternal disease progression occurred.Conclusion: Antiretroviral therapy and cesarean delivery resulted in 0% mother-to-child HIV transmission in tested infants in this cohort.High obstetric complication rates and frequent late diagnosis underscored the need for enhanced prenatal screening and individualized delivery planning.Neonatal outcome data were limited to parameters with complete and consistent documentation.
